From the onset of this custom home design on Canandaigua Lake, our clients knew their desire to be integrated with the lake and its views from as many rooms as possible. Their taste in the classic interior finishes of clean and crisp whites compliment the views we framed throughout. What the photos don’t show is the process of planning this home from razing and rebuilding an existing structure to the extensive planning board meetings for the proposed design goals. This neighborhood has strict zoning laws that make designing a clients wishes and dreams a challenge. We worked intimately with the client and town zoning boards to gain necessary approvals for this custom lake home design. As a result we were able to achieve their desired goals for the design of this house and the development of this property.

Denise Quade Design
Floating shelves are sitting in front of a mirrored backsplash that helps reflect the light and make the space feel bigger than it is. Shallow bar height cabinets are below and offer more storage for liquor bottles. A raised countertop on the great room area offers seating for four.

Glazed Cherry cabinets anchor one end of a large family room remodel. The clients entertain their large extended family and many friends often. Moving and expanding this wet bar to a new location allows the owners to host parties that can circulate away from the kitchen to a comfortable seating area in the family room area. Thie client did not want to store wine or liquor in the open, so custom drawers were created to neatly and efficiently store the beverages out of site.

In this instance, revered interior designer – Su Satchwell, worked with Heaven & Stubbs to design
and provide the homeowners with an entire room dedicated to a bar.
A combination of upholstered bar stools and fitted wall – bench seating ensures that friends and
family can all sit in comfort whilst admiring the many details that the room has to offer.
The bar itself has a wonderful elliptical design embellished with suede fabric flutes and brass plinth
detailing whilst the wall behind, with its drinks shelving and picture frame TV, has an antique mirror
finish.
As always, with Heaven and Stubbs, function is of as equal importance as form. Therefore, the bar
benefits from such details as glass toped – pull drink preparation surfaces and a beautiful – yet
supremely durable ‘Star Galaxy’ granite work-top edged in a hardwearing, died maple.
